I am bringing up a new (to me) K3.
What makes the drive level track between bands without the nasty ALC overshoots? The drive from the K3 sometimes also takes a while to settle down when coming up on a new band. This drives me crazy in changing bands and modes while chasing W1AW/# stations. What to invoke to make the output of the K3 go back to 100W when the KPA is off or stby? It presently stays at the ~30W needed for 500W out. Hi Dick,
If you have the "15-pin" cable that comes with the KPAK3AUX cable set, you can set the K3's CONFIG:PWR SET to PER BND and that will do what you want to do. Have a look at the intro_guide at http://www.ke7x.com/home/k-line-introduction-and-set-up-guide The slow to come up to power might be caused by how you have your ALC set up. It is not used to control power. > What to invoke to make the output of the K3 go back to 100W when the KPA is
> off or stby? It presently stays at the ~30W needed for 500W out. Is this a > KPA or K3 issue? If you have the Aux Cable to connect the K3 to KPA500, then in the K3 Config menu, PWR SET PER_BAND. While still in that menu, the "1" key locks/unlocks the Power knob, and it notices whether the KPA500 is in Operate, or not. I set my K3 to be 100W on each band when KPA500 is not in Operate, and the appropriate level to drive the KPA500 when it is in operate.
